WebJun 1, 1988 · Reve's puzzle is a generalization of the standard Towers of Hanoi whereby the number of pegs is extended from 3 to k ⩾ 2. A simple and elegant recursive algorithm for solving Reve's puzzle is presented. Its optimality is assured by an algorithm for optimally splitting a tower of n discs into two subtowers. WebJan 31, 2013 · The Frame-Stewart algorithm for the 4-peg variant of the Tower of Hanoi, introduced in 1941, partitions disks into intermediate towers before moving the remaining …

WebIn 1941, Frame [5] and Stewart [15] independently proposed algorithms which achieve the same numbers of moves for the k-peg Tower of Hanoi problem with k ≥ 4 pegs. Klavˇzar et al.[7] showed that seven different approaches to the k-peg Tower of Hanoi problem, including those by Frame and Stewart, are all equivalent, that is, achieve the same ...
